Ingredients:
Crafting Your Chocolate Masterpieces
The journey to these incredible Salted Brownie Cookies begin extracts with gathering your ingredients and preparing your workspace. Having your eggs at room temperature is crucial for creating a well-emulsified batter, leading to a tender cookie. You can achieve this quickly by placing whole eggs in a bowl of warm water for about 5-10 minutes.
Step 1: The Dry Ingredients Foundation
In a medium b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, and the 1/8 teaspoon of salt. This initial step ensures that your leavening agents are evenly distributed throughout the dough, which will contribute to the perfect texture of your cookies. Set this dry mixture aside.
Step 2: Melting the Chocolatey Goodness
In a heatproof bowl set over a saucepan of simmering water (a double boiler method), melt the 6 tablespoons of unsalted butter. Once the butter is fully melted, stir in the 1/4 cup of unsweetened cocoa powder and the optional 1 teaspoon of espresso powder. Whisk until the mixture is smooth and glossy. Remove this bowl from the heat and let it cool slightly. This melted chocolate mixture is the heart of our brownie flavor, so take your time and ensure it’s smooth and free of lumps.
Step 3: Building the Wet Batter
In a large bowl, combine the 2 room-temperature large eggs and the 1 room-temperature egg yolk. Add the 1 cup of granulated sugar and the 1 tablespoon of vegetable oil. Whisk vigorously until the mixture is light and frothy, which should take about 2-3 minutes. This aeration is important for creating a lighter cookie. Next, stir in the 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ract.
Step 4: Bringin extractg It All Together
Gradually add the slightly cooled melted chocolate mixture from Step 2 into the wet ingredients from Step 3, whisking until well combined. The batter will be thick and deeply chocolatey. Now, it’s time to incorporate the dry ingredients. Add the flour mixture from Step 1 to the wet ingredients in two additions, mixing gently after each addition until just combined. Be careful not to overmix, as this can develop the gluten in the flour and result in tougher cookies. Finally, fold in the 1 cup of semi-sweet chocolate chips. These will add delightful pockets of melted chocolate throughout your cookies.
Step 5: The Art of Baking and Finishing Touches
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line baking sheets with parchment paper. Using a cookie scoop or two spoons, drop rounded balls of dough onto the prepared baking sheets, leaving about 2 inches between each cookie to allow for spreading. For that classic brownie look and extra chocolatey punch, gently press a few extra semi-sweet chocolate chips onto the tops of each cookie dough ball. This is also the moment to sprinkle a pinch of sea salt flakes over the top of each cookie, if you are using them. The salt is essential for balancing the sweetness and bringin extractg out the complex chocolate flavors.
Bake for 10-12 minutes, or until the edges are set and the centers still look slightly soft. They will continue to cook on the baking sheet as they cool. Allow the cookies to cool on the baking sheets for about 5 minutes before carefully trans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ely. The cooling process is essential for them to firm up and achieve that perfect chewy texture. Enjoy these delectable Salted Brownie Cookies with a glass of milk or a cup of coffee!

Frequently Asked Questions:
Why are my brownie cookies not chewy enough?
Ensure you’re not overbaking them. They should look slightly underdone in the center when you take them out of the oven, as they will continue to cook on the baking sheet. Using melted butter, as opposed to creamed butter, also contributes to a chewier texture in brownie cookies.
Can I make these ahead of time?
Yes, absolutely! You can bake the Salted Brownie Cookies and store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. They are often even better the next day as the flavors meld together. You can also freeze baked cookies for longer storage.

Salted Brownie Cookies
Chewy brownie cookies with a rich chocolate flavor, topped with sea salt flakes for a perfect sweet and salty balance.
Ingredients
-
1 cup All-Purpose Flour
-
1 tsp Baking Powder
-
1/8 tsp Salt
-
2 Large Eggs (room temperature)
-
1 Large Egg Yolk (room temperature)
-
1 cup Granulated Sugar
-
1 tbsp Vegetable Oil
-
1 tsp Vanilla Extract
-
6 tbsp Unsalted Butter
-
1 cup Semi-Sweet Chocolate Chips
-
1/4 cup Unsweetened Cocoa Powder
-
1 tsp Espresso Powder (optional)
-
Sea Salt Flakes (for topping cookies (optional garnish))
Instructions
-
Step 1
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Line baking sheets with parchment paper. -
Step 2
In a medium b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, and 1/8 tsp salt. -
Step 3
In a large bowl, melt the unsalted butter in the microwave or on the stovetop. Stir in the granulated sugar and vegetable oil until well combined. -
Step 4
Beat in the 2 large eggs one at a time, then the egg yolk and vanilla extract until smooth. -
Step 5
Add the unsweetened cocoa powder and espresso powder (if using) to the wet ingredients and mix until just combined. -
Step 6
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mixing until just combined. Do not overmix. -
Step 7
Fold in the semi-sweet chocolate chips. -
Step 8
Drop rounded tablespoons of dough onto the prepared baking sheets, leaving about 2 inches between cookies. -
Step 9
Top each cookie with a few extra chocolate chips and a sprinkle of sea salt flakes, if desired. -
Step 10
Bake for 9-11 minutes, or until the edges are set and the centers are still slightly soft. -
Step 11
Let the cookies cool on the baking sheets for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.
